- START DATE: July 1, 2026 POSITION SUMMARYThe School Business Administrator/Board Secretary serves as the chief financial and operational officer of the district and is responsible for overseeing all business functions, financial management, facilities operations, transportation, food services, risk management, purchasing, and Board of Education support services
- The successful candidate will work collaboratively with the Superintendent, Board of Education, district administrators, staff, and community stakeholders to ensure efficient and effective district operations that support student achievement
